Antenna Testing for NASA’s SkyFall Mission

Description
SkyFall ground-penetrating radar engineer Maya Román connects a coaxial cable to a test antenna in the Environmental Test Lab’s electromagnetic interference testing chamber at NASA’s Jet Propulsion Laboratory in Southern California.
The antenna was pointed up during test to minimize reflections and interferences with the antenna pattern during the measurement.
Equipped with four instruments each, the three SkyFall aircraft will follow in the footsteps of the agency’s Ingenuity Mars Helicopter, which flew 72 times over nearly three years, proving that powered, controlled flight is possible in the rarefied Martian atmosphere. It also demonstrated how an aerial perspective can generate valuable data by helping NASA’s Perseverance Mars rover team plan time-saving routes and choose locations for science-gathering.
SkyFall is expected to launch aboard NASA’s Space Reactor-1 Freedom in late 2028.
